Comparable Facts
Compare Bay Path University in Longmeadow, MA with Marietta College in Marietta, OH on tuition, admissions, graduation, earnings, and student body data using the table above.
Bay Path University is larger than Marietta College based on total student enrollment (2,605 students vs. 1,109 students)
Location, institution type, and student-faculty ratio
- Bay Path University is located in Longmeadow, MA (Large Suburban setting); Marietta College is in Marietta, OH (Small City setting).
- Bay Path University is a private, non-profit 4-year institution. Marietta College is a private, non-profit 4-year institution.
- Student-to-faculty ratio: Bay Path University 8:1; Marietta College 10:1.
Bay Path University vs. Marietta College Cost Comparison
Which college is more expensive, Bay Path University or Marietta College?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).
- The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Bay Path University than Marietta College ($15,463 vs. $22,007).
-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Marietta College are 2.1% lower than at Bay Path University ($13,296 vs. $13,582).
- Marietta College is 3.5% more expensive for in-state tuition than Bay Path University (about $1,350 more per year; $39,652.00 vs. $38,302.00).
- Out-of-state tuition is 3.5% higher at Marietta College than at Bay Path University (about $1,350 more per year; $39,652.00 vs. $38,302.00).
- A larger share of students receive grant aid at Marietta College than at Bay Path University (100% vs. 92%).
- The average total grant financial aid received by Bay Path University students is 0.8% larger than aid received by Marietta College students ($31,821 vs. $31,554).

Bay Path University vs. Marietta College Graduation Outcomes Comparison
How do outcomes compare for Bay Path University and Marietta College?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).
- Bay Path University's six-year graduation rate (65%) is higher than Marietta College's (51%).
- Graduates from Marietta College earn a median of about $8,400 more per year than Bay Path University graduates about ten years after starting college ($51,900 vs. $43,500),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
- Among federal student loan borrowers, Bay Path University graduates have a $2,989 lower median loan debt than Marietta College graduates ($24,011 vs. $27,000).
- Among borrowers, Bay Path University graduates have an estimated $31 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than Marietta College graduates ($248 vs. $279).
- More Marietta College gra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Bay Path University students, three years after graduation. (73% vs. 54%)
